I see that moving the texture creation code from graft* to draw-gadget* 
solves the issue. I'm wondering if this is a bug, since the 
documentation for graft* mentions that resources can be allocated on 
this method (and to use find-gl-context to ensure the correct GL context 
is setup before allocating the resources).

The modified the code shown below works correctly:

M: i-gadget graft*
 drop ;

M: i-gadget draw-gadget*
 [ { 10 10 } ] dip
 dup texture>> [ ]
 [ dup image>> { 0 0 }  >>texture texture>> ] ?if
 [ draw-texture ] curry with-translation ;

image-gadget seems to have been implemented in the same way though (i.e. 
setting up textures is done on the 1st call into draw-gadget*).

[Factor-talk] Problem drawing an image in a new window

2015-11-29 Thread Sankaranarayanan Viswanathan
Hi,

Hi, i'm facing a problem drawing textures in a new window. when I
create the gadget and add it to the listener using gadget. the image
shows corretly, when I create the gadget and use open-window, the
image does not show up on the new window.

Sample code below:

TUPLE: i-gadget < gadget
image texture ;

:  ( path -- gadget )
[ i-gadget new ] dip load-image >>image ;

M: i-gadget pref-dim*
image>> dim>> [ 20 + ] map ;

M: i-gadget graft*
dup find-gl-context
dup image>> { 0 0 }  >>texture drop ;

M: i-gadget ungraft*
dup find-gl-context
dup texture>> dispose
f >>texture drop ;

M: i-gadget draw-gadget*
[ { 10 10 } ] dip texture>> [ draw-texture ] 
curry with-translation ;

! In the listener

"vocab:images/sprites/game_drop.png"  gadget.

! the above works and shows the image in the listener

"vocab:images/sprites/game_drop.png"  "i-gadget" open-window

! the above opens a new window but the image does not show

What could I be missing?
